Hi. This is my first visit and message. I hav a 6 yr old female Akita called Kita. I love her so much but wish I could take her out off the lead and let her play
Like I see other dogs play. But she wants to fight every dog in sight. Can this change?

Hi. We do not let ours off lead. Akitas are not known for their recall. (There are the odd exception) We use 50ft lines so they can run but not run off.
The aggressive behaviour can be tackled with socialisation and training classes.

Agree with others, any sign of a problem then do not allow any dog off lead, lunge lines are a great way of allowing dogs lots of freedom whilst still under control.
